apt.conf question
Hello List,
I had quite some trouble with a machine recently when trying to install a new
mailman version. Several software packages were uninstalled without further
asking.
I found the following entry in the /etc/apt/apt.conf file and now I think of
becoming a little angry :-( because I know the two parameters "Assume Yes
'true'" and "Purge 'Yes'" can really do a lot of harm.
Or are they necessary for working automatic updates?
I doubt that... there should be a better way, or not?
Any help appreciated!
-------------------------
{
// Options for apt-get
Get
{
Assume-Yes "true";
Fix-Missing "yes";
Show-Upgraded "yes";
Purge "true"; // really purge! Also removes config files
List-Cleanup "true";
ReInstall "false";
};
--------------------------
